Transaction 2f748337944cdcb786901eb36ac61182155ed871f507a08ccaee8309aeb566ca
1 Input
1 Output
-
2f748337944cdcb786901eb36ac61182155ed871f507a08ccaee8309aeb566ca:0
- value
- 62160
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c134ff319909a413ceed8470a57a81c663ffce5
- address
- bc1qesf5lucejzdyz08wmprs54agr3nrll89zjegqz